As Jedd Fisch begins his third year as head coach in Tucson, the Arizona Wildcats are focused on continuing their growth and earning a spot in a bowl game.

After improving their win total from one to five games in 2022, the Wildcats are now pondering how far a squad full of experienced players can go in their upcoming games.

Arizona sportsbooks are skeptical of the Wildcats’ chances to reach the Pac-12 title game for the first time since 2014.

BetMGM AZ is giving UA odds of +50000 for winning a national title, while Caesars Sportsbook Arizona has the Wildcats at +5000 odds for winning a Pac-12 championship.

The Wildcats are currently in eighth place in the conference standings, with USC (+190), Oregon (+280), Washington (+350), Oregon State (+550), Utah (+600), UCLA (+1600), and Washington State (+2500) ahead of them.

Arizona’s first sole Pac-12 victory since joining the conference in 1978 would be secured if they manage to rally and win the title in 2023. The Wildcats previously shared the Pac-10 title with UCLA in 1998.

Wildcats’ Position as the 2023 Season Begins

The Wildcats are entering 2023 with momentum following the signing of two consecutive top-40 recruiting classes (as per 247 Sports) for the first time since 2010. The standout was the record-breaking 22nd-ranked group in 2022.

The team’s continual progress relies heavily on quarterback Jayden de Laura, who showcased his talent with an impressive 3,685 passing yards and 25 touchdowns (along with 13 interceptions) in 2022.

De Laura is expected to prioritize versatile wide receiver Jacob Cowing, who has chosen to return to Tucson for another season following an impressive showing of 85 receptions, 1,034 yards, and seven touchdowns.

Cowing is expected to step up and play a bigger role in Arizona’s offense now that top receiver Dorian Singer has transferred to USC.

Tetairoa McMillan, a sophomore wide receiver, is looking to build on his standout freshman year performance, which saw him amass 702 yards and score eight touchdowns. If McMillan can maintain his high level of play, the Wildcats have the potential to have one of the most exciting offenses in college football.

The ground game may be the key to success in the upcoming season, with Michael Wiley returning to Tucson after leading the team in rushing yards and touchdowns last year with 771 yards and eight scores.

Arizona’s skill position players will be joined by a trio of three-star recruits, Malachi Riley from Corona Centennial and Brandon Johnson from Palmdale Highland.

If those players can regain their previous form and Arizona can enhance their defense, the potential is limitless.

Analyzing Arizona’s 2023 Schedule

The quality of opponents on the schedule presents a significant challenge for Arizona in their quest for their first bowl game since 2017.

With four upcoming games against opponents who have won 10 or more games in 2022, as well as a non-conference game against SEC team Mississippi State (which finished with a 9-4 record), reaching six wins could be quite a difficult feat.

Arizona will need to be nearly flawless, as they face Northern Arizona and UTEP at home in non-conference games before a challenging matchup against the Bulldogs in Starkville.

Following that, the Wildcats will play against a 3-9 Stanford team away from home, then return to Arizona Stadium to face Washington on September 30th.
